In the realm of digital artistry and photo editing, having the right tools is paramount to achieving professional results. One such essential tool for retouching and editing tasks is a high-quality retouching monitor. These specialized monitors are designed to provide accurate color reproduction, precise detail rendering, and optimal viewing angles, enabling photographers, graphic designers, and retouchers to work with confidence and precision. In this article, we’ll delve into the importance of retouching monitors, key features to consider, and how they can elevate your editing workflow.
A retouching monitor, also known as a color-accurate display or a professional-grade monitor, is specifically engineered to meet the demanding requirements of color-sensitive tasks such as photo retouching, graphic design, and video editing. Unlike standard monitors, which may sacrifice color accuracy for affordability, retouching monitors prioritize color precision and consistency, making them indispensable for professionals who rely on accurate color representation in their work.
Q1: Do I need a retouching monitor if I’m not a professional photographer or designer? A1: While retouching monitors are essential for professionals who require precise color accuracy, hobbyists and enthusiasts can also benefit from the enhanced visual experience and improved image quality offered by these monitors.
Q2: How often should I calibrate my retouching monitor? A2: It’s recommended to calibrate your retouching monitor regularly to ensure consistent color accuracy. Depending on usage and environmental factors, calibration every one to three months is typically sufficient.
Q3: Can I use a retouching monitor for gaming or general multimedia consumption? A3: While retouching monitors excel in color accuracy and detail rendering, they may not offer the high refresh rates and response times desired for gaming.
Q4: Are retouching monitors compatible with color calibration devices? A4: Yes, most retouching monitors are compatible with popular color calibration devices such as X-Rite i1Display Pro and Datacolor SpyderX.
Q5: What factors should I consider when choosing a retouching monitor for my specific needs? A5: Consider factors such as display size, resolution, color gamut coverage, connectivity options, and budget.
